Titration

Titration is the progressive or gradual increase in drug dosage to reach an optimal therapeutic outcome.

Treatment

The management and care of a patient to combat a disease or disorder. Can take the form of medicines, procedures, or counseling and psychotherapy.

Taper

Tapering is the practice in pharmacotherapy of lowering the dose of medication incrementally over time to help prevent or reduce any adverse experiences as the patient’s body makes adjustments and adapts to lower and lower doses.

Non-pharmacologic therapy

Non-pharmacologic therapy are treatments that do not involve medications, including physical treatments (e.g., exercise therapy, weight loss) and behavioral treatments (e.g., cognitive behavioral therapy).
